Finding the Best Public Administration Bachelor's Degree School for You

In 2020-2021, 998 degrees and certificates were awarded to public administration students who went to a Texas college or university. This makes it the #59 most popular major in the state.

Top Texas Schools for a Bachelor's in Public Administration

Our 2023 rankings named Stephen F Austin State University the best school in Texas for public administration students working on their bachelor’s degree. SFASU is a large public school located in the town of Nacogdoches.
